Best Places to Visit in Mumbai: A Local's Perspective



As a lifelong Mumbaikar, I've seen countless corners of this dynamic city. Forget the typical tourist traps; here’s my personal list of the top 10 places you absolutely need to visit, offering a genuine taste of Mumbai life. First, there's the magnificent Gateway of India, a landmark monument. Then, wander through the colourful chaos of Crawford Market, a sensory overload . Don't fail to see the stunning architecture of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j Terminus, formerly Victoria Terminus - it’s truly remarkable. For some peaceful reflection, head to the Banganga Tank, a secluded stepwell. Then, immerse yourself in the art scene at the Dr. Bhau Daji Lad Museum, showcasing local heritage. Shoppers will love Colaba Causeway's diverse array of boutiques. Experience the spiritual aura at the Shree Siddhivinayak Temple, a renowned Ganesh temple. Take a scenic boat ride on the Arabian Sea and soak in the city views. Lastly, discover the street food paradise of Mohammed Ali Road, a culinary adventure. You’ll find something for anybody here!

Historical Mumbai: Places to Visit & Stories to Uncover



Delve through the layered tapestry of historic Mumbai, a urban area brimming with captivating narratives and notable landmarks. Explore the iconic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j Terminus, once Victoria Terminus, a magnificent example of Victorian Gothic architecture, and wander through the animated lanes of Crawford Market, a classic trading hub. Hear the tales of Elephanta Island's ancient temples, a important World Heritage site, or examine the colonial influence at the Gateway of India. Be sure to see Dr. Bhau Daji Lad Mumbai City Museum to receive a deeper insight into the area's evolution and its special heritage. Each building whispers a story of a changing past.

The Finest Kept Secrets : Unusual Places to Discover



Beyond the bustling streets of Colaba and the iconic Monument, Mumbai conceals a trove of lesser-known gems. Wander to the picturesque Kanheri Caves, a ancient Buddhist site nestled within the Sanjay Gandhi Park. Discover the colorful chaos of Dhobi Ghat, where clothes are laundered in a truly unforgettable display. For a serene escape, seek out the verdant Sanjay Gandhi Park, a natural sanctuary. Don't overlook to appreciate the rustic beauty of Worli Sea Face, offering fantastic panoramas of the Open Sea. These offbeat destinations offer a new angle on the vibrant city.
